中文文章语言风格探索:Marionette Inspector和Backbone框架的实践应用
语言风格MarionetteChrome插件Firefox插件 ### 摘要
本文探讨了中文文章的语言风格在技术文档中的应用,特别是在介绍Marionette Inspector作为Chrome Web Store和Firefox Add-ons的插件时。此外,文章还涵盖了在BBConf Talk中对Backbone框架的深入讨论,旨在帮助开发者更好地理解和使用这些工具。
### 关键词
语言风格, Marionette, Chrome插件, Firefox插件, Backbone框架
## 一、Marionette Inspector语言风格探索
### 1.1 Marionette Inspector的语言风格特点
在介绍Marionette Inspector这款强大的前端开发工具时,中文文章的语言风格显得尤为重要。为了确保用户能够轻松理解并掌握该工具的功能与使用方法,作者采用了清晰、准确且易于理解的语言风格。具体来说,这种语言风格的特点包括:
- **简洁明了**:避免使用过于复杂或冗长的句子结构,确保每个概念都能被快速捕捉到。
- **专业术语的恰当使用**:对于诸如“DOM”、“CSS选择器”等专业术语,文章会在首次出现时给出简短定义,并在后续提及时保持一致。
- **示例丰富**:通过具体的代码片段和实际应用场景来解释功能,使抽象的概念变得直观易懂。
- **引导式叙述**:采用逐步引导的方式介绍Marionette Inspector的各项功能,帮助读者从基础操作逐渐过渡到高级用法。
- **互动性元素**:鼓励读者亲自尝试文中提到的操作步骤,增强学习过程中的参与感。
### 1.2 Marionette Inspector在Chrome插件和Firefox插件中的应用
Marionette Inspector作为一款跨平台的开发工具,在Chrome Web Store和Firefox Add-ons上均有着广泛的应用。它不仅能够帮助开发者高效地调试网页应用,还能促进不同浏览器之间的一致性测试。
- **Chrome Web Store**:在Chrome浏览器中安装Marionette Inspector后,开发者可以利用其丰富的功能来检查和修改页面元素,实现对网页布局、样式和脚本的精细控制。此外,通过集成的性能分析工具,还可以轻松识别并优化网页加载速度等问题。
- **Firefox Add-ons**:对于Firefox用户而言,Marionette Inspector同样提供了强大而全面的支持。它允许开发者直接在浏览器环境中执行JavaScript代码,方便进行实时调试。同时,该插件还支持多标签页调试,使得跨页面追踪问题变得更加简单快捷。
无论是Chrome还是Firefox版本的Marionette Inspector,都致力于为用户提供一个友好且高效的开发环境,帮助他们更轻松地应对各种挑战。
## 二、Backbone框架语言风格探索
### 2.1 Backbone框架的语言风格特点
在介绍Backbone框架时,中文文章的语言风格同样扮演着至关重要的角色。为了确保开发者能够迅速掌握这一轻量级MVC库的核心概念与实践技巧,作者精心选择了既专业又易于理解的语言风格。以下是Backbone框架介绍中所体现的语言风格特点:
- **清晰定义**:对于Backbone框架的基本概念如模型(Model)、集合(Collection)、视图(View)等,文章会首先给出明确的定义,以便读者建立正确的认知基础。
- **逐步引导**:通过一系列由浅入深的例子,逐步引导读者理解如何使用Backbone构建复杂的应用程序。从简单的数据绑定开始,逐渐过渡到事件处理、路由配置等高级特性。
- **代码示例**:提供简洁明了的代码片段,帮助读者直观地理解Backbone框架的工作原理及其在实际项目中的应用方式。
- **最佳实践**:分享一些经过验证的最佳实践,比如如何组织代码结构、如何利用插件扩展功能等,以提升应用程序的可维护性和性能。
- **社区资源**:推荐一些官方文档之外的优质资源,如博客文章、视频教程等,鼓励读者进一步探索和学习。
### 2.2 Backbone框架在BBConf Talk中的深入探讨
在BBConf Talk中,专家们围绕Backbone框架进行了深入的讨论,不仅分享了最新的开发趋势和技术要点,还探讨了如何克服常见挑战。以下是会议中几个关键议题的概述:
- **性能优化**:讨论了如何通过减少DOM操作次数、合理利用事件代理等方式提高Backbone应用的运行效率。
- **模块化设计**:介绍了如何利用AMD或CommonJS规范将Backbone应用拆分成多个独立模块,以降低单个文件的大小并简化依赖管理。
- **状态管理**:探讨了在大型项目中如何有效地管理应用状态,包括使用Backbone.Marionette等扩展库来构建层次化的视图系统。
- **跨平台开发**:分享了如何利用Backbone结合其他工具(如PhoneGap)进行移动应用开发的经验,以及在此过程中遇到的问题和解决方案。
- **未来展望**:展望了Backbone框架的发展方向,包括与其他现代前端框架(如React、Vue.js)的融合趋势,以及如何适应不断变化的技术生态。
通过这些深入的讨论,参会者不仅能够获得实用的知识和技巧,还能对未来的技术趋势有更清晰的认识。
## 三、中文文章语言风格发展探讨
### 3.1 中文文章语言风格的发展历程
随着信息技术的飞速发展,中文文章的语言风格也在不断地演变和发展之中。从早期的技术文档到如今的在线教程和指南,语言风格经历了显著的变化,以适应不同的传播媒介和技术背景下的读者需求。
- **传统技术文档**:早期的技术文档往往采用较为正式和学术化的语言风格,注重理论知识的阐述和专业术语的使用。这种风格虽然保证了内容的专业性和准确性,但有时也会因为过于晦涩难懂而让非专业人士望而却步。
- **互联网时代的转变**:进入互联网时代后,随着网络文化的兴起,中文文章的语言风格开始趋向于更加通俗易懂和贴近日常生活的表达方式。技术文档也开始注重用户体验,采用更为平易近人的语言风格,力求让所有读者都能够轻松理解。
- **多媒体融合**:近年来,随着多媒体技术的发展,文章中越来越多地融入了图片、视频等元素,这不仅丰富了文章的表现形式,也促使语言风格向更加直观和生动的方向发展。例如,在介绍Marionette Inspector这样的工具时,通过结合动态演示和交互式示例,能够让读者更加直观地感受到工具的强大功能。
### 3.2 中文文章语言风格的未来发展趋势
随着技术的不断进步和社会文化环境的变化,中文文章的语言风格也将继续向着更加多元化和个性化的方向发展。
- **个性化定制**:未来的文章可能会根据读者的兴趣偏好和阅读习惯,自动调整语言风格和内容深度,以提供更加个性化的阅读体验。例如,在介绍Backbone框架时,可以根据读者的技能水平自动调整文章的难度等级。
- **互动性增强**:随着虚拟现实(VR)、增强现实(AR)等技术的应用,未来的文章将更加注重互动性和沉浸感,通过模拟真实场景来帮助读者更好地理解和掌握技术知识。
- **多模态融合**:未来的文章将更加注重多种媒介的融合,不仅仅是文字和图片,还将包括音频、视频等多种形式,以满足不同读者的学习偏好。例如,在BBConf Talk中,可以通过录制演讲者的讲解视频,配合文字说明和代码示例,为读者提供全方位的学习资源。
- **全球化视野**:随着全球化的加深,中文文章的语言风格也将更加注重国际化,采用更加通用和易于理解的表达方式,以便跨越文化和语言障碍,让更多国际读者受益。
## 四、总结
本文详细探讨了中文文章的语言风格在技术文档中的应用,特别是针对Marionette Inspector这款跨平台开发工具以及Backbone框架的介绍。通过对语言风格特点的分析,我们发现简洁明了、专业术语的恰当使用、丰富的示例以及引导式的叙述方式是确保技术文档易于理解的关键因素。无论是Chrome Web Store上的Marionette Inspector插件还是Firefox Add-ons版本,都强调了清晰而友好的用户界面设计,以帮助开发者高效地调试和优化网页应用。而在Backbone框架的介绍中,则通过逐步引导和最佳实践分享,帮助读者快速掌握这一轻量级MVC库的核心概念与实践技巧。此外,文章还回顾了中文文章语言风格的发展历程,并展望了其未来可能的发展趋势,包括个性化定制、增强互动性以及多模态融合等方面。通过这些深入的探讨,旨在为开发者提供实用的知识和技巧,同时也为中文技术文档的语言风格提供了有价值的参考。